Sri Ganganagar Homoeopathic Medical College Hospital and Research Center, is an elite institution that is registered with the Central Council of Homeopathy (CCH). The college provides extensive courses in homeopathy at undergraduate and postgraduate levels. The admission process is formulated to identify the best-suited candidates for their different programs in homeopathy.
The college generally offers admissions at the national-level entrance examination. For the BHMS course, the admissions are at the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test. For postgraduate studies such as MD, admissions are made considering scores at the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test for Post Graduate (NEET PG).
Eligibility requirements for BHMS admission are passing 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as compulsory subjects. For MD courses, the candidates need to have passed their BHMS degree from a recognized university. Program-wise eligibility requirements are framed in terms of CCH and NEET/NEET PG regulations.
Application Process
Application procedures for Sri Ganganagar Homoeopathic Medical College Hospital and Research Center depend on the program:
For BHMS:
1. Take the NEET examination.
2. Clear NEET with a marks score above cutoff.
3. Get registered through the counseling procedure as per state or central counseling authority guidelines.
4. Select Sri Ganganagar Homoeopathic Medical College Hospital and Research Center during counseling procedure.
5. In case assigned a seat, proceed to the college for documentation check and formalities of admission.
For MD Courses:
1. Take the NEET PG examination.
2. Clear NEET PG by obtaining a rank over the cutoff.
3. Enroll yourself for the counseling procedure of NEET PG.
4. Proceed for counseling in which seat will be allotted considering the merit along with preferences.
5. If assigned a seat at Sri Ganganagar Homoeopathic Medical College Hospital and Research Center, follow the admission process as per the college guidelines.
Degree wise Admission Process
BHMS: The Bachelor of Homeopathic Medicine and Surgery course of Sri Ganganagar Homoeopathic Medical College Hospital and Research Center is provided with 100 seats for admission. Admissions are granted based on the candidate's score in the NEET examination. The admissions follow the merit list obtained from the scores of NEET, in accordance with the reservation rules if applicable.
MD Courses: The college has six MD specializations, each with 5 seats. They are MD Homoeopathic Materia Medica, MD Organon of Medicine and Philosophy, MD Repertory, MD Psychiatry, MD Practice of Medicine, and MD Paediatrics. Admissions to these postgraduate courses are made on the basis of NEET PG scores. Candidates are shortlisted through a counseling process based on their NEET PG rank and choice.
